buen dia compañeros actual mente estoy en una pantalla sap la cual estoy ingresando información por medio del script
el cual me llena la información de un excel con 1 columna y 3 filas el problema es que no me recorre el excel y solo me ingresa el primer campo y se repite en orden descendente en el sap
codigo
'Llamar archivo de excel -
Dim objExcel
Dim objWorkBook
Set objExcel = CreateObject(“EXCEL.APPLICATION”)
'Colocar la RUTA
Set objWorkBook = objExcel.Workbooks.Open(“C:\Users\andresfernando.lozan\Desktop\codigs.xlsx”)
'Colocar la hoja de excel
Set Hoja=objWorkBook.Sheets(“Hoja1”)
objWorkBook.Sheets(“Hoja1”).Select
objExcel.visible=true
Hoja.Select
intFila=2
x=0
'Colocar el nombre de la primera variable y que esté en la columna A
Codigo=Hoja.Range(“A” & intFila).value
'while Codigo <> “”
'en esta parte declare x en 0 para tener un contador y ir cambiando de fila en sap
session.findById(“wnd[0]”).maximize
session.findById(“wnd[0]/usr/btn%W_MATNR%APP%-VALU_PUSH”).press
session.findById(“wnd[1]/usr/tabsTAB_STRIP/tabpSIVA/ssubSCREEN_HEADER:SAPLALDB:3010/tblSAPLALDBSINGLE/ctxtRSCSEL_255-SLOW_I[1,” & x & “]”).text = Codigo
x=x+1
intFila = intFila +1
'WEND